Actress Jayati Bhatia, popular for her role as Mataji in Sasural Simar Ka, has recently opened up about her career in the film industry. Bhatia made her debut in Hindi television during the 90s and has been working in the industry since then. During her initial years, the actress was seen in various popular TV shows, including Challenge, Tu Tu Main Main, Kaise Kahoon, Kitne Cool Hai Hum, among other shows. Throughout her career, Bhatia has played multiple roles in different shows; however, her performance in Sasural Simar Ka helped her to mark a permanent presence in the industry. She played the role of Nirmala Bharadwaj AKA Mataji, the matriarch of the family. Sasural Simar Ka quickly became a fan favourite soap opera and made its way onto the list of longest-running Indian television series.
In a recent interview with Times Entertainment, Bhatia reflected on her role in Sasural Simar Ka as she said, “It’s my role as Mataji in Sasural Simar Ka, which was a game-changer for me. Even today, people call me Mataji.” Bhatia did an extraordinary performance in the show for 7 years before returning in a new character to the second season of the show. In this season, Bhatia played the role of Geetanjali Gopichand Oswal. The show ran for 2 years and ended in April 2023.
Although she has been in the industry for decades, Bhatia still feels the excitement and nervousness of a newcomer when she walks into a set. “I still get nervous because there’s a certain expectation from me as a performer. Even though I have been working in the industry since 1997, I’m excited about every role that I take up,” Bhatia told Times Entertainment.
Along with TV serials, Bhatia has been cast in multiple films and OTT shows. She was recently seen playing the role of Phatto on Heeramandi, which got wide acclaim from critics and audiences. “Sometimes people even call me Phatto, my character from Heeramandi,” Bhatia said during the interview, explaining all these roles are close to her heart, but in the present she’s looking forward to exploring new roles.
